Evaluating Automated Trading Strategies
Before deploying an automated trading strategy into the live market, it's crucial to rigorously analyze its performance through backtesting. Backtesting involves running historical market data against your strategy to observe its performance. This technique allows you to pinpoint potential strengths and weaknesses before risking real capital. By analyzing backtesting results, traders can fine-tune their strategies, minimizing the risk of losses in live trading.
Successful backtesting requires careful selection of historical data relevant to your strategy. It's also important to account for transaction costs and slippage, as these can significantly impact performance.
- Additionally, it's essential to conduct multiple backtests with different market conditions to gauge the robustness of your strategy.
- Ultimately, backtesting should be an iterative method that involves continuous analysis and modification based on the results obtained.

Ethical Dilemmas in Automated Trading
As algorithmic trading penetrates financial markets, a plethora of ethical issues emerge. One key dilemma is the potential for market distortion, as automated systems could be exploited to perform rapid-fire trades that unfairly advantage certain participants. Furthermore, the accountability of algorithmic decisions is debated, making it difficult to identify and rectify errors that could perpetuate existing inequalities. Additionally, the increasing reliance on automation raises worries about job displacement in the financial sector, as human traders are potentially supplanted by complex algorithms.
